Austin Film Festival Winners


Screenplay Competition

Adult Category, CheckMate, written by Frank Reilly ($4,000)

Comedy Category, you down with OCD?, written by Stephen Falk ($1,000)

Family Category, On Top of the World, Nancy Hendrickson ($4,000)


Feature Film Winner

The Testimony of Taliesin Jones, Maureen Tilyou (writer), Martin Duffy (director)


Short Film Winner

“In God We Trust,” Jason Reitman (writer/director)


Student Short Winner

“Genesis and Catastrophe,” Jamie Ruddy & Jonathan Liebesman (writers), Jonathan Liebesman (director)
